Key Phrases
不好意思,我想說你今天的穿搭真的很好看。
bù hǎo yì sī wǒ xiǎng shuō nǐ jīn tiān de chuān dā zhēn de hěn hǎo kàn
Excuse me, I want to say your outfit today looks really good.
你的外套和手錶很搭,很有品味。
nǐ de wài tào hé shǒu biǎo hěn dā hěn yǒu pǐn wèi
Your jacket and watch match well; you have great taste.
如果你不介意,我想請你喝一杯。
rú guǒ nǐ bù jiè yì wǒ xiǎng qǐng nǐ hē yī bēi
If you don't mind, I'd like to buy you a drink.

Lesson Roleplay
Imagine you notice someone’s stylish outfit and warm smile, so you politely compliment them, and the friendly conversation naturally leads to inviting them for a drink.
不好意思,我想說,你今天的穿搭真的很好看。
bù hǎo yì sī wǒ xiǎng shuō nǐ jīn tiān de chuān dā zhēn de hěn hǎo kàn
Sorry, I just wanted to say that your outfit today looks really great.
真的嗎?謝謝你,你這樣說很貼心。
zhēn de ma xiè xiè nǐ nǐ zhè yàng shuō hěn tiē xīn
Really? Thank you, that’s very thoughtful of you to say.
你的外套和手錶很搭,看起來很有品味。
nǐ de wài tào hé shǒu biǎo hěn dā kàn qǐ lái hěn yǒu pǐn wèi
Your jacket and watch match really well, and you have great taste.
你觀察得很仔細,我很開心。
nǐ guān chá dé hěn zǎi xì wǒ hěn kāi xīn
You’re very observant, and that makes me happy.
而且你的笑容很溫暖,讓人很放鬆。
ér qiě nǐ de xiào róng hěn wēn nuǎn ràng rén hěn fàng sōng
And your smile is so warm; it makes people feel really relaxed.
Lesson Vocabulary & Phrases
不好意思 / 請問一下
bù hǎo yì sī qǐng wèn yī xià
Excuse me / May I ask something?
🇹🇼 [不好意思] is the everyday softer opener in Taiwan when you want attention politely; [請問一下] sounds a bit more like "may I ask." At a bar, [不好意思] usually feels warmer and less stiff.
See breakdown →不好意思
bù hǎo yì sī
Sorry / Excuse me
🇹🇼 [不好意思] does a lot of social work in Taiwan: it can mean sorry, excuse me, or a gentle way to get someone's attention. It's especially useful with strangers because it sounds polite without being overly formal.
See breakdown →我想
wǒ xiǎng
I want to...
💬 [我想] often softens what comes next, so it can feel more like "I'd like to..." than a blunt "I want." You can reuse it with another verb: [我想認識你] (I'd like to get to know you).
See breakdown →說
shuō
To say
我想說
wǒ xiǎng shuō
I want to say
💬 [我想說] often means "I wanted to say..." as a soft lead-in, not just literally "I want to say." It's handy before a compliment because it makes the line feel less abrupt.
See breakdown →今天
jīn tiān
Today
的
de
Of; -'s
💬 Put [的] after a time or person to let it describe a noun: [今天的穿搭] = today's outfit, [你的外套] = your jacket. The pattern is easy to reuse with other nouns.
See breakdown →穿搭
chuān dā
Outfit; clothing combination
🇹🇼 [穿搭] is very Taiwan-current and common in everyday talk, especially about someone's overall look rather than one clothing item. It sounds natural in compliments about style.
See breakdown →今天的穿搭
jīn tiān de chuān dā
Today's outfit
🇹🇼 [今天的穿搭] sounds natural and modern in Taiwan when praising someone's overall style. It's often smoother than commenting on their body, so it lands as flattering without being too forward.
